Rumah >pangkalan data >tutorial mysql >Bagaimanakah Saya Boleh Mendayakan Akses Root Jauh ke Pelayan MySQL Saya?

Bagaimanakah Saya Boleh Mendayakan Akses Root Jauh ke Pelayan MySQL Saya?

Linda Hamilton
Linda Hamiltonasal
2024-12-07 08:59:11372semak imbas

How Can I Enable Remote Root Access to My MySQL Server?

Meningkatkan Akses Root MySQL untuk Sambungan Jauh

Keperluan untuk mendayakan akses root jauh dalam MySQL biasanya timbul apabila menguruskan pangkalan data pada pelayan jauh. Panduan komprehensif ini akan membimbing anda melalui langkah-langkah yang diperlukan untuk mencapai objektif ini.

Untuk bermula, adalah penting untuk memastikan pengguna root mempunyai keistimewaan akses yang sesuai. Jalankan arahan berikut sebagai pengguna root, menggantikan 'kata laluan' dengan kata laluan akar semasa anda:

G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Y 'password';

Seterusnya, anda perlu mengikat MySQL kepada semua antara muka rangkaian yang tersedia untuk membolehkan sambungan daripada mana-mana hos. Untuk mencapai ini:

  1. Edit fail konfigurasi MySQL. Untuk Ubuntu 16, fail ini terletak di /etc/mysql/mysql.conf.d/mysqld.cnf.
  2. Cari baris yang bermula dengan "bind-address" dan ulasnya menggunakan "#" watak:
#bind-address = 127.0.0.1
  1. Mulakan semula perkhidmatan MySQL untuk menggunakan perubahan:
service mysql restart

Untuk mengesahkan bahawa MySQL kini terikat kepada semua antara muka, jalankan arahan berikut sebagai root:

netstat -tupan | grep mysql

Langkah-langkah ini seharusnya membenarkan akses root ke MySQL dengan berkesan daripada mana-mana hos di internet. Ingat bahawa pengubahsuaian ini memberi kesan kepada semua pengguna dengan kata laluan akar, jadi adalah penting untuk melindungi pelayan anda dengan secukupnya.

Atas ialah kandungan terperinci Bagaimanakah Saya Boleh Mendayakan Akses Root Jauh ke Pelayan MySQL Saya?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n